Overview
SAT20 is a "Satoshi Standard" Bitcoin native asset issuance and circulation protocol. Its core feature is the secure, economical, and fast flow of assets tied to Satoshis. The circulation protocol is the core, aiming to support the secure, economical, and fast circulation of all native assets on the mainnet. It supports all UTXO-based asset issuance protocols on Bitcoin. Satoshi Network is a native extension of the Bitcoin mainnet, dedicated to expanding the liquidity of native assets on the Bitcoin mainnet and exploring a viable path for the development of the Bitcoin ecosystem.
SatoshiNet
SatoshiNet is a native extension of the BTC mainnet. Based on the BTCD source code, it provides a secure, fast, and economical native circulation environment for BTC and the mainnet's native assets. SatoshiNet is a centralized showcase of all achievements of the SAT20 protocol and the foundation for our in-depth development of the BTC ecosystem.
Features of SatoshiNet:
A native, extended layer 2 network for BTC: Based on the RSMC contract, asset security is guaranteed by the mainnet.
Bridgeless: Anyone can independently transfer assets to SatoshiNet or withdraw them back to the mainnet without the need for a centralized funding bridge.
Coinless: All assets originate from the BTC mainnet.
Common consensus: Same address, same network fee, same assets, and same core code (based on BTCD).
Secure, economical, and fast: User-controlled assets ensure fast block times and low fees.
Smart Contract Support: An innovative channel contract framework provides a more flexible and secure smart contract solution.
Asset Circulation Protocol (STP)
The SAT20 Asset Circulation Protocol, also known as the Satoshi Transcending Protocol (STP), is a protocol based on Lightning Network channels that defines the rules for the circulation of Satoshi assets.
Features of the Satoshi Transcending Protocol:
BTC Native: Inherits the Lightning Channel RSMC protocol, with asset security ensured by the BTC mainnet, giving users full control.
Full Asset Support: Supports native asset protocols on the BTC mainnet, such as Ordinals, Runes, BRC20, ORDX, and more.
Dynamic Lightning Channel Technology
Simple Atomic Interface:
Open and close channels
Lock and unlock assets
Splicing in/out
Extensible channel contract framework: Expand the RSMC protocol into a channel contract comparable to smart contracts
Asset Issuance Protocol (ORDX)
The SAT20 asset issuance protocol is an enhanced version of the Ordinals protocol. It is used to issue assets called SAT20 assets. These assets are bound to satoshis and inherit the properties of satoshis:
Satoshis are not destructible, so the assets are also non-destructible.
The data bound to satoshis is immutable, so once the assets are issued, they cannot be modified.
Wherever the satoshis are, the assets are also present, allowing assets to freely move across different networks alongside satoshis.
Assets belong to the owner of the satoshis, so when satoshis are transferred, the assets are transferred as well.
The non-fungible nature of satoshis determines the non-fungibility of assets, making them inherently SFT (Semi-Fungible Token) assets.
Satoshis can be bound to any data, including smart contracts, enabling assets to have a certain level of intelligence.
Vision
One sat, one world.
Everyone can enjoy the benefits of the BTC network.
Last updated
Was this helpful?